Condividi tramite


ModelBindingMessageProvider Classe

Definizione

Provider per i messaggi di errore rilevati dal sistema di associazione del modello.

public ref class ModelBindingMessageProvider : Microsoft::AspNetCore::Mvc::ModelBinding::Metadata::IModelBindingMessageProvider
public ref class ModelBindingMessageProvider abstract
public class ModelBindingMessageProvider : Microsoft.AspNetCore.Mvc.ModelBinding.Metadata.IModelBindingMessageProvider
public abstract class ModelBindingMessageProvider
type ModelBindingMessageProvider = class
    interface IModelBindingMessageProvider
type ModelBindingMessageProvider = class
Public Class ModelBindingMessageProvider
Implements IModelBindingMessageProvider
Public MustInherit Class ModelBindingMessageProvider
Ereditarietà
ModelBindingMessageProvider
Derivato
Implementazioni

Costruttori

ModelBindingMessageProvider()

Inizializza una nuova istanza della classe ModelBindingMessageProvider.

ModelBindingMessageProvider(ModelBindingMessageProvider)

Inizializza una nuova istanza della ModelBindingMessageProvider classe basata su originalProvider.

Proprietà

AttemptedValueIsInvalidAccessor

Messaggio di errore che il sistema di associazione del modello aggiunge quando Exception è di tipo FormatException o OverflowException, valore è noto e l'errore è associato a una proprietà.

MissingBindRequiredValueAccessor

Messaggio di errore che il sistema di associazione del modello aggiunge quando una proprietà con un oggetto associato non è associata BindRequiredAttribute .

MissingKeyOrValueAccessor

Messaggio di errore che il sistema di associazione del modello aggiunge quando la chiave o il valore di un KeyValuePair<TKey,TValue> oggetto è associato, ma non entrambi.

MissingRequestBodyRequiredValueAccessor

Il messaggio di errore del sistema di associazione del modello aggiunge quando non viene fornito alcun valore per il corpo della richiesta, ma è necessario un valore.

NonPropertyAttemptedValueIsInvalidAccessor

Messaggio di errore che il sistema di associazione del modello aggiunge quando Exception è di tipo FormatException o OverflowException, valore è noto e l'errore è associato a un elemento o parametro di raccolta.

NonPropertyUnknownValueIsInvalidAccessor

Messaggio di errore che il sistema di associazione del modello aggiunge quando Exception è di tipo FormatException o OverflowException, valore sconosciuto e l'errore è associato a un elemento o parametro di raccolta.

NonPropertyValueMustBeANumberAccessor

Gli helper html e tag del messaggio di errore aggiungono per la convalida lato client di formati numerici. Visibile nel browser se il campo per un float elemento di raccolta o un parametro di azione (ad esempio) non ha un valore formattato correttamente.

UnknownValueIsInvalidAccessor

Messaggio di errore che il sistema di associazione del modello aggiunge quando Exception è di tipo FormatException o OverflowException, valore sconosciuto e l'errore è associato a una proprietà.

ValueIsInvalidAccessor

Il messaggio di errore di fallback visualizza i helper HTML e tag quando una proprietà non è valida, ma la ModelErrorproprietà ha nullErrorMessages.

ValueMustBeANumberAccessor

Gli helper html e tag del messaggio di errore aggiungono per la convalida lato client di formati numerici. Visibile nel browser se il campo per una float proprietà (ad esempio) non ha un valore formattato correttamente.

ValueMustNotBeNullAccessor

Messaggio di errore che il sistema di associazione del modello aggiunge quando un null valore è associato a una proprietà nonNullable .

Si applica a